Agave americana Care
Caring for your Agave americana is like nurturing a diva—give it the right amount of sun, water, and love, and it will thrive! These succulents prefer well-draining soil and a sunny spot, so make sure to pamper them with the right conditions. Water sparingly, as they’re not fans of soggy feet. With a little TLC, your Agave will reward you with stunning rosettes and a personality that shines brighter than a Hollywood star.

Agave americana Propagation
Propagating Agave americana is like playing matchmaker for plants! You can easily create new plants from offsets, or “pups,” that sprout around the base. Just gently remove these little cuties and plant them in their own pots. With a little love and the right conditions, you’ll have a whole family of Agave americana ready to take center stage in your garden. Who knew matchmaking could be so rewarding?
Agave americana Habitat
Native to the arid regions of Mexico, Agave americana thrives in dry, sunny environments. It’s like the ultimate sunbather, soaking up rays and looking fabulous while doing it. This succulent is perfectly adapted to withstand drought, making it a superstar in xeriscaping. So, if you’re looking to create a low-maintenance garden that can handle the heat, Agave americana is your go-to plant!
Agave americana Flowering
When Agave americana decides to bloom, it’s like a grand finale at a fireworks show! After years of growth, this succulent sends up a towering flower stalk that can reach up to 30 feet tall. The flowers are a sight to behold, attracting pollinators and turning heads. But beware, once it flowers, the plant will die, leaving behind a legacy of pups. It’s a bittersweet moment, but oh, what a show!

Agave americana Pests
While Agave americana is generally tough, it’s not immune to the occasional pest party. Watch out for mealybugs and aphids, who might try to crash the succulent soirée. A little neem oil or insecticidal soap can send these uninvited guests packing. Keep an eye on your plant, and it will continue to thrive, looking fabulous and pest-free!
